Notice Title
Procurement for the Design, Supply, Installation and Commissioning of Hydrogen Equipment for the Purpose of Production, Compression, Storage and Dispensation of Hydrogen Fuel ("Hydrogen Technology Package") (Revised Tender)
Notice Description
Please note this is a revised tender, following the decision to discontinue tender ref 20230214-000004 (2023/S 000-004438). bp Aberdeen Hydrogen Energy Limited (bpAHEL) is a Joint Venture (JV) between bp and Aberdeen City Council (ACC), secured through a public procurement process. The JV has been created with the purpose of delivering a scalable green hydrogen production, storage and distribution facility in the city powered by renewable energy. The facility is targeting manufacture and dispensing of between 770 kilograms (min.) and 1000 kilograms (peak) of green hydrogen per day - enough to fuel 25 buses and a range of other fleet vehicles. This contract notice relates to the following scope of work: Optimised and integrated design, supply, installation, testing and commissioning of the following, to produce and dispense the required volume and rates, at the required quality, of hydrogen per day: - Hydrogen electrolyser and associated power unit - Ancillary package equipment (i.e., compression, conditioning, storage, as required) - Refueling/dispensing hub for vehicles - Interconnections between supplied packages including pipework, cabling etc. - Control Alarms and Safety Instrumented Systems (SIS), Fire & Gas, Emergency Shutdown etc., as per referenced control philosophy and as vendor deems necessary. (Capable of being integrated into a wider site SCADA system.) - Clearly defining any utility requirements (power/water) and working with others to ensure seamless integration. - Allowance for hydrogen import facilities

Lot 1
Description of Scope bpAHEL intend to conduct a procurement for the provision of the required hydrogen technology (electrolyser unit) and hydrogen refueling station (compression, storage, dispensation, as required). An output-based specification has been developed and Client is looking for a safe, reliable, and operable system based on the most-competitive industry-led, standardized offering from the tendering process, considering the specifications within the project brief but also the bidder's own capability and experience, supplier relationships, proprietary technology, and knowledge of delivering cost effective hydrogen solutions within the current environment. It is recognized that there will be options to improve in certain areas of the project, such as plant availability, redundancy, delivery schedule, etc., and these will be evaluated post-contract award in collaboration with chosen Contractor through appropriate cost benefit analysis.
